State the Swinging Flashlight Test
The patient looks into the distance while the examiner shines a bright light first into one eye for a few seconds and then the other. As the light shifts from the normal eye to the affected eye, the direct light stimulus is not enough to keep the pupils small, therefore both eyes dilate.
